Instances Microwave Techniques, a number one model in progressive RF and microwave interconnect assemblies, cables, and connectors, launched its XtendedFlex 178 steady flex coaxial cable. Designed for plastic cable drag chains, the XF-178 cable is constructed for purposes requiring fixed movement and suppleness, equivalent to robotics and industrial automation applied sciences in giant distribution facilities.

Constructed with a novel mixture of supplies, together with a stranded silver-plated copper-clad metal middle conductor, FEP dielectric, tin-plated copper braid, and a rubber jacket, the cable is each versatile and sturdy to outlive the pains of hundreds of thousands of flexures. Moreover, Instances Microwave Techniques’ efficiency testing has confirmed the XtendedFlex 178’s reliability. Utilizing a rolling flex tester robotic, the cable was subjected to 1 million flexes and maintained low insertion loss and VSWR specs whereas preserving mechanical flexibility. The cable continued to carry out properly even after 5 million flexes.
